DEFINITION
DEFINE
“A Nurse is a person who is trained to care for the
sick”.

*The New Lexicon Webster’s, 1987.


More than 150 years ago,
as Florence Nightingale put
it: "Nursing is a practical
action that protects the
environment around the
patient to help patients
recover."
Nightingale,1860

Florence Nightingale
Virginia Henderson (1960)
“The function of nursing is
to help individuals, sick or
healthy, to help them
improve their quality of life
and recover quickly. Nurses
need to be physically fit,
smart, knowledgeable and
quick to work. "

According to the WHO, there were 27.9 million nurses
globally in 2020, making up nearly 60 percent of the
health professions and the largest occupational group
in the health sector. However, there is an estimated
shortage of up to 13 million nurses around the world.
HISTORY OF NURSING
HISTORY OF THE WORLD NURSING INDUSTRY

In the third century in Rome, women


did not assume the role of nurse, but
rather men, called Parabolani
Brotherhood. This group of men took
care of sick people.
HISTORY OF THE WORLD NURSING INDUSTRY

In the 1860's, Phoebe (Polish-


American) took care of soldiers during the
Civil War in America.

Phoebe Yates Levy


1823 - 1913
HISTORY OF THE WORLD NURSING INDUSTRY

In the fourth century, Fabiola of


(Rome) volunteered to make
her luxury home a hospital,
helping the poor and sick to
feed themselves.

Fabiola Patron Saint of Nurses


HISTORY OF THE WORLD NURSING INDUSTRY

In 1633, the Sisters Chariting established in


France. It was the first organization under
the Pope to take care of sick people. The
organization has sent nurses around the
world, and has established hospitals in
Canada, the United States and Australia.
HISTORY OF THE WORLD NURSING INDUSTRY

In the eighteenth - nineteenth centuries, social


reform changed the role of women in society in
general. During this period, a British woman
gained the world's respect and worshipped the
founder of Nursing. Florence Nightingale.

Florence Nightingale (1820 -


1910).

The birth of the Vietnam Nurses Association
On October 26, 1990, the Vietnamese Nursing Association opened its
first congress. (1990 - 1993). The board of the Nursing Association
has 31 members in both regions. Ms. Vi Thi Nguyet Ho is the president
and three vice presidents.
On October 26, 2017, the 7th National Congress of Nurses (2017 -
2022) was held in Da Nang and the new Executive Board consisting of
29 members.
Over the course of 28 years of development, the Association
has had seven congresses: 1990, 1993, 1997, 2002, 2007, 2012,
2017. Each Congress marks a milestone in the development of
the Nursing Field and Professional Nurses . The Executive
Board of the VIIth Congress of the term of 2017 - 2022 has 29
members, the Association size: 59/63 provinces, 91,619
members.
On October 27, 2017, the 8th National Congress of the
Vietnam Nurses Association.
